For example, if you cash in on under $100,000 annually, significantly $25,000 of rental income losses qualify as deductible, and can save thousands of dollars on other income origins through this write-off. However, if you earn over $100,000 a year, this deduction begins to phase out, until it is completely gone for taxpayers earning $150,000 and above annually.

You be compelled to explain to the IRS you actually were insolvent during the method of discussion. The best way conduct so is actually fill the government form 982: Reduction of Tax Attributes Due to discharge of Indebtedness. Alternately, you're able to also fasten a letter in your own tax return giving reveal break from the total debts and also the total assets that you would. If you do not address 1099-C from the IRS, the irs will file a Lien and actions are taken on you in associated with interests and penalties may be annoying!
